The length of each side of an equilateral triangle is 74mm, correct to the nearest millimeter. Calculate the smallest possible p
Olin [163]

Answer:

  221 mm

Step-by-step explanation:

The dimension 74 mm is presumed to mean that the actual length could be anywhere in the interval [73.5, 74.5). So, the minimum perimeter is ...

  3 × 73.5 = 220.5 ≈ 221 . . . millimeters

_____

The perimeter of an equilateral triangle is 3 times the side length, since all three sides of the triangle are the same length.

A triangle has the following coordinates: (8,6), (4,-4), (-9,-2) After a reflection, it has the coordinates (-8,6), (-4, -4), (9
Phantasy [73]

Answer:

The y-axis

Step-by-step explanation:

When the x coordinate changes signs but the y doesn't, it reflects across the y-axis
